Five Years in the Life is a Canadian reality television series which aired on CBC Television from 1968 to 1972.
Contents
Premise
The lives of selected Canadian families were profiled in this series with the initial intent to revisit them five years later. However, public interest in the series caused the CBC to revisit featured families more frequently and to profile additional families. Profiled people included an architect, an Inuit artist, a Jamaican immigrant and a lighthouse operator from Newfoundland. The various segments were produced with numerous directors.
